Is Google Classroom 6x Safe to Use?


The safety of Google Classroom 6x depends on various factors, including the site’s source, security measures, and content.
Here’s what you need to consider before using it:
Unofficial Third-Party Website
- Google Classroom 6x is NOT an official Google service.
- It is a third-party platform that provides access to unblocked games, which means it is not monitored or endorsed by Google.
Potential Security Risks
- Some unblocked game sites may contain ads, pop-ups, or links to external websites, which could lead to phishing scams or malware.
- Avoid downloading files or clicking suspicious ads to prevent viruses or tracking software from being installed on your device.
Privacy Concerns
- Many of these sites do not require logins, but they may track user activity through cookies and other data collection methods.
- Schools may also monitor student internet activity, so accessing unblocked gaming sites could violate school policies.
Safe Browsing Practices
- Stick to well-known and trusted versions of Google Classroom 6x to minimize risks.
- Use ad blockers and antivirus software to protect your device.
- Always exit pop-ups and avoid clicking on unfamiliar links.
